16-bit

Projects inspired by the 16 bit console generation from the late 80s and early 90s. Including the consoles Super Nintendo, Sega Genesis, and PC Engine/TurboGrafx-16.

RPG Maker

Games made with ASCII/Enterbrain/Kadokawa Games' RPG Maker series of game engines. Includes, but is not limited to the following:

  • RPG Maker 2000
  • RPG Maker 2003
  • RPG Maker XP
  • RPG Maker VX
  • RPG Maker VX Ace
  • RPG Maker MV
